New lifestyle content agreement for Teenage girls

23 June 2005 by axxxr
Smartphones Technologies announced a mobile content agreement with G Studios, LLC, to license Earth 2 Jane and Chosen Girls, two new lifestyle brands targeting teen and tween girls.

Earth 2 Jane is a hip, fresh brand bringing a positive message to teen girls. The Earth 2 Jane characters include fashion designer Jane, art-crazy Paris, photography buff Jett, glamour girl Liberty, honor student Emma, and surfer girl Tess. Earth 2 Jane merchandising includes a creative line of novelties featuring everything from dolls, sportswear, plush, charms, stationery and much more. An Earth 2 Jane television show is planned for next year.

Chosen Girls features Trinity, Harmony and Melody, three rock star role models to help promote Christianity's coolness to tween and teen girls. Chosen Girls will launch in January 2006 and promises to touch girls worldwide with a distinct message that says, "Don't be afraid to take a stand -- you're worth it"! Chosen Girls inspires and empowers youth to authentically live their beliefs in a fashionable, trend forward way.

"Teens and young adults can associate with the Earth 2 Jane girls," said Mike Merrill, Chairman & CEO of Smartphones Technologies. "We're pleased to help Earth 2 Jane extend their brand to reach their demographic. In today's mobile society, if it's not on the Internet, it's on their phone."

Smartphones Technologies will enable wireless customers to download Earth 2 Jane wallpapers, ringtones, ringback tones, animations and video clips to their mobile phones. Smartphones will create licensed Earth 2 Jane and Chosen Girls mobile content and distribute it to interested wireless carriers and content providers worldwide.

"Our innovative designs can be downloaded and changed as often as each customer wants," said Michael Gordon, co-owner of G Studios. "We're excited about this opportunity with Smartphones.
